Information Disclosure Vulnerability in Red Hat Advanced Cluster Management
CVE-2026-73122
7.7HIGH
What is CVE-2026-73122?
A vulnerability exists in the multicloud-operators-channel component of Red Hat Advanced Cluster Management, allowing a compromised agent from a managed cluster to access sensitive information without authorization. This flaw permits the unauthorized reading of all Secrets and ConfigMaps within any Channel namespace on the hub. As a result, credentials from other tenants' Git and Helm repositories may be disclosed, potentially leading to severe data exposure risks.
